What to consider when choosing a detective agency

The detective's hourly rate is never uniform because it depends on:

  • the degree of difficulty of the case being solved
  • type of order performed
  • the number of people involved in the detective observation
  • amount of resources and equipment used to complete the task


When the order was non-standard, its final valuation may differ from the generally accepted price list provided on the website or presented to the client. The valuation of the order includes the number of hours during which the detective collected evidence, conducted observation and prepared a report covering all the activities performed along with conclusions.

Before you decide to use the services of a given detective agency, it is important to check whether it will cope with the task you want to entrust to it. Some detective agencies specialize in specific assignments. You should also carefully check the company's details, type of activity and whether it has the necessary license issued by the Minister of Interior and Administration allowing you to run an office. Each detective must have a valid detective license authorizing them to perform their work. Performing detective services without these documents is a crime under the law.

A website emanating with professionalism is not everything. When choosing the services of a given detective agency, it is worth considering recommendations and confirmed data. By choosing an office that employs several private detectives or operates 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, the chance that the case commissioned by us will be solved faster and more efficiently increases.
